What are wisdom teeth and how many are there?
There are 4 of these teeth in total in each individual. Their locations can be defined as lower right back, upper right back, lower left back and upper left back. It is very unlikely that they will grow at the same time. They usually grow in different periods. Therefore, it corresponds to different stages of the oral structure. Therefore, it is quite natural for the same individual to remove one tooth with pain, one without pain and the others without feeling at all.
Some wisdom teeth that are genetically weak may not erupt at all. It can remain embedded in the lower part without causing any health problems. However, such a situation does not mean that there is no wisdom tooth.
At what age do wisdom teeth start to erupt?
These teeth, which are located at the very back, begin to erupt between the ages of 17 and 25. Some people may have great difficulty in this process. Because of the pain it causes in the mouth and jaw parts, a very serious pain can be felt. However, in some individuals, it can be seen that these teeth appear at the age of 30, not in their 20s. In some, they may not erupt.
Teeth have a certain order when they erupt and these teeth, which are located at the back, erupt last. After all the teeth erupt, space is allocated for the wisdom teeth. If there is no space, it cannot fully erupt, but it can cause pain.
What are the symptoms of wisdom teeth?
When it can find enough space in the gums, it comes out as it should. It can show a healthy development and cause no problems. However, it can often cause problems due to lack of space. The common symptoms of Fethiye wisdom teeth are listed as follows;
- Pain in teeth and gums
- Gum sensitivity
- Pain in the jaw and ear
- Swelling of the lymph nodes
- Headache
- Bad odor in the mouth
- Pain during chewing
How to recognize impacted wisdom teeth?
If the patient has symptoms, x-rays are taken first and the condition is learned. A very detailed imaging is performed with X-rays. At the same time, wisdom teeth are examined and the situation is understood. Afterwards, it is determined whether this tooth will be removed by a normal tooth extraction method or by surgery. A treatment plan is created accordingly and progress is made.
